Minara Natural Onsen Riraku

The largest open-air bath in western Japan, featuring the warming waters that spring from ancient strata 2 billion years old at a depth of 2000m, and the beauty-enhancing waters that flow from strata 70 million years old at a depth of 1500m, can be enjoyed in comparison. There is a sauna adorned with Jurassic wood stone, and the women's bath also has a steam sauna. The rest area offers free drinks, Yogibo, and a library, allowing for a relaxing time. It is attached to accommodation facilities where you can fully enjoy the 200 million-year romance of the warming waters. Hotel stays range from 5,700 to 30,000 yen per person on weekdays.

Kadosho Kadosho

Since 1936, the handmade ice candy shop, commonly known as "Kadomise," has been preserving its craft. It is only sold from early May to mid-October, offering products that highlight the flavors of the ingredients, with a selection of 6 types of soft serve and 7 types of ice candy.

White Waterfall Park

The park, which is located 6km upstream from the mouth of the Hijikawa River and features a beautiful landscape of autumn leaves and waterfalls, which was praised by poet Ejijo Noguchi for "Autumn Shirataki, tree and tree maple, and cotton curtains on the mountain." A number of waterfalls can be seen when walking along the walking path.

Oshima

The western gateway of the Geiyo Islands, located 4km above the sea in Imabari and connected with the Imabari by the Kimajima Strait Bridge of the trifecta suspension bridge. The Yoshiumi area is home to the largest Bara Park in Shikoku and the Koeoyama Observation Park, which overlooks the Seto Inland Sea. The Miyakubo district is the birthplace of the Ōshima stone and is related to the Murakami Pirate.
